Internal Memo — Budget Request

To the sales leads: Operations has submitted a budget request to fund two additional demo kits for the Vellane product line and travel support for the Ashgrove territory push. Finance expects a decision within two weeks. No changes to current spending limits until then; log any urgent needs with your regional coordinator. Background on the request's purpose appears below.

board note of fahaf-fadug: Gilixax Logistics is in early talks to buy Praiusax Partners for about $8.1 million. The Pramir launch date is September 23, and nothing goes to the press before then.

## Runbook: Quillsearch autocomplete latency

For release manager, pre-ship check. If typeahead p95 exceeds 120ms on the Quillsearch staging ring, the suggest index is likely cold or mid-rebuild. Check the indexer queue depth first; anything over 10k pending means a rebuild is in flight — hold the release. Warm the index with the standard replay script, then re-run the latency probe twice. Do not ship while the shard count on node fern-3 differs from its peers. The staging service runs with the configuration values below.

service settings:
[casax]
port = 6379
team = rusir
host = casax.zemvarhq.corp
region = outer-4
access_code = ac_9808ce
timeout_ms = 1500

### v2.4.1 — GleamTrace GPU profiler

Hey newcomers! This release finally fixes the memory-leak false positives on multi-stream workloads and adds a neat flamegraph view for per-kernel allocations. Snapshot exports are about 40% smaller too. If you're setting up GleamTrace for the first time, start with the quickstart doc. Questions, bug reports, or confused stares should go to the maintainer named below.

approver of bagug-bagag = Holael Pramir

Welcome aboard! This repo tracks the Driftwatch investigation into why our cron jobs on the Hollowpine cluster fire late. Copy env.sample to .env, set DRIFTWATCH_INTERVAL to 60 for local runs, and point DRIFTWATCH_LOG_DIR somewhere writable. The collector also pulls scheduler metrics from the Clockvane service, which needs authentication. Add that credential to your .env on the line immediately following this one.

vault entry, yahif-yajep: COURIER_KEY29=b802bdf8034096b65a51c6ba5abe2